TTEC (TTEC) Projected to Post Quarterly Earnings on Thursday

TTEC (NASDAQ:TTECGet Free Report) will likely be announcing its Q1 2025 earnings data after the market closes on Thursday, May 8th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of $0.25 per share and revenue of $506.74 million for the quarter. TTEC has set its FY 2025 guidance at 0.950-1.200 EPS.

TTEC (NASDAQ:TTECG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 27th. The business services provider reported $0.12 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.21 by ($0.09). TTEC had a positive return on equity of 5.00% and a negative net margin of 14.69%. The business had revenue of $567.44 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$575.73 million. On average, analysts expect TTEC to post $0 EPS for the current fiscal year and $1 EPS for the next fiscal year.

TTEC Stock Performance

TTEC stock traded up $0.05 during midday trading on Tuesday, reaching $3.86. 54,646 shares of the company’s st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 603,890. The firm has a market capitalization of $184.52 million, a PE ratio of -0.55,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.53 and a beta of 1.22. TTEC has a 52 week low of $3.11 and a 52 week high of $8.45.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 3.47, a quick ratio of 1.93 and a current ratio of 1.93. The company has a 50-day moving average price of $3.69 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$4.24.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

A number of research analysts recently issued reports on the company. Canaccord Genuity Group reduced their price target on TTEC from $4.50 to $3.50 and set a “hold” rating on the stock in a report on Monday, March 3rd. StockNews.com upgraded TTEC from a “s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Saturday, March 8th. Three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and two have given a bu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the company presently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and a consensus target price of $10.83.

TTEC Holdings, Inc operates as a customer experience (CX) company that designs, builds, and operates technology-enabled customer experiences across digital and live interaction channels. It operates through two segments, TTEC Digital and TTEC Engage. The TTEC Digital segment provides CX technologies for contact center as a service, customer relationship management, and artificial intelligence (AI) and analytics; creates and implements strategic CX transformation roadmaps; sells, operates, and provides managed services for cloud platforms and premise based CX technologies; creates proprietary IP to support industry specific and custom client needs; and offers CX consulting services.
